What are the specifications of FFSH30120ADN_F155?
| Manufacturer Package Code | TO247G03 |
| Reach Compliance Code | Compliant |
| YTEOL | 5.95 |
| Additional Feature | HIGH RELIABILITY, PD-CASE |
| Application | EFFICIENCY |
| Case Connection | CATHODE |
| Configuration | COMMON CATHODE, 2 ELEMENTS |
| Diode Element Material | SILICON CARBIDE |
| Diode Type | RECTIFIER DIODE |
| Forward Voltage-Max (VF) | 1.75V |
| JEDEC-95 Code | TO-247 |
| JESD-30 Code | R-PSFM-T3 |
| JESD-609 Code | e3 |
| Non-rep Pk Forward Current-Max | 125A |
| Number of Elements | 2 |
| Number of Phases | 1 |
| Output Current-Max | 15A |
| Package Body Material | PLASTIC/EPOXY |
| Package Shape | RECTANGULAR |
| Package Style | FLANGE MOUNT |
| Peak Reflow Temperature (Cel) | NOT SPECIFIED |
| Power Dissipation-Max | 195W |
| Rep Pk Reverse Voltage-Max | 1200V |
| Reverse Current-Max | 200 µA |
| Reverse Test Voltage | 1200V |
| Surface Mount | NO |
| Technology | SCHOTTKY |
| Terminal Finish | Matte Tin (Sn) - annealed |
| Terminal Form | THROUGH-HOLE |
| Terminal Position | SINGLE |
| Time@Peak Reflow Temperature-Max (s) | NOT SPECIFIED |
| Package | Transistor Outline, Vertical |

Frequently Asked Questions
How does FFSH30120ADN_F155 support high-voltage rectification designs?
It is a silicon carbide rectifier diode rated at 1200 V and 30 A, suitable for high-efficiency power stages that need high blocking voltage.
Which package and connection details should PCB designers account for?
The device uses manufacturer package code TO247G03 with a cathode case connection and common cathode, 2 elements configuration for 30 A class power routing.
